packaging: add linux-firmware-ivi 67/1667/2
authorArtem Bityutskiy <artem.bityutskiy@linux.intel.com>
Mon, 10 Sep 2012 12:46:37 +0000 (15:46 +0300)
committerArtem Bityutskiy <artem.bityutskiy@linux.intel.com>
Tue, 11 Sep 2012 07:06:39 +0000 (10:06 +0300)
Add new binary package which will contain IVI firmware. The
linux-firmware-crossville package will eventually die.

This patch also does few unrelated clean-ups an re-arrangements, sorry
for not separating that out.

Change-Id: Id2547ab04d3f17bd55b9d6ae1b075af4237c5b25
Signed-off-by: Artem Bityutskiy <artem.bityutskiy@linux.intel.com>
packaging/linux-firmware-crossville.spec

index 831f5f8..7e515e1 100644 (file)
@@ -2,26 +2,31 @@ Name:         linux-firmware-crossville
 Version:       0.1
 Release:       4
 Summary:       firmware files for Crossville IVI platform drivers
-
 BuildArch:      noarch
-
 Group:         System/Kernel
 License:       Redistributable, no modification permitted
-
 Source0:       %{name}-%{version}.tar.bz2
 
+%description
+Firmware files for kernel drivers specific to the Crossville IVI platform
+
+%package -n linux-firmware-ivi
+Group:         System/Kernel
+Summary:       Firmware for IVI platforms
+
+%description -n linux-firmware-ivi
+Firmware files for IVI kernel drivers
+
 %package docs
 Group: Documentation
 Summary: linux-firmware-crossville license/readme files
 
-%description
-Firmware files for kernel drivers specific to the Crossville IVI platform
-
 %description docs
 linux-firmware-crossville license/readme files
 
+
 %prep
-%setup
+%setup -q
 
 %build
 # Nothing to build
@@ -35,5 +40,9 @@ ln -s TDA7706_OM_v3.0.2_boot.txt $RPM_BUILD_ROOT/lib/firmware/TDA7706_OM.txt
 %defattr(-,root,root,-)
 /lib/firmware/*
 
+%files -n linux-firmware-ivi
+%defattr(-,root,root,-)
+/lib/firmware/*
+
 %files docs
 %doc LICENCE.* README.*